Accommodation Description:
LONDON AT YOUR THRESHOLD - Whether you are visiting London for business or pleasure, the Lancaster Court Hotel is the ideal location for your comfort and convenience. You will be surrounded by history and the best attractions that London can offer. The hotel itself is an impressive Listed and imposing double-fronted Victorian building overlooking Hyde Park

Meticulous refurbishment, individual decoration of rooms along with the care and attention of our staff will enhance your stay. The rest of this web site describes the comprehensive facilities available to visitors, but do feel free to contact us with any queries. EVERYTHING ON YOUR DOORSTEPStep outside the hotel and you are spoilt for choice

Famous shops and attractions are within comfortable walking distance. You could stroll through Kensington Gardens or across Hyde Park to fashionable Knightsbridge and Harrods. Equally close is the famous variety of shopping in the W1 district - Oxford Street, Regent Street and Bond Street

Tourists will want to visit Buckingham Palace, Madame Tussauds, Big Ben, Portobello Antiques Market, Carnaby Street, the galleries and museums. The restaurants, theatres and nightlife of Londons Mayfair and Soho are close by and whatever you want to do, our staff will happily advise you on how to get the best from your time in the Capital. 630 ACRES OF HYDE PARKJust a few minutes walk away is the spectacular Hyde Park which is 630 acres in size - perfect for jogging, strolling and picnics

This Day in British History

16 May, 1532

Sir Thomas More resigns as Lord Chancellor

More's conscience will not allow him to support Henry VIII's claims of state authority over religion
